JOB FILLED - Food Safety Manager

Job Description: 
The Food Safety Manager supervises the Food Safety and Sanitation Department’s employees while also ensuring that the food safety system at the plant is properly written, documented, and implemented - thus ensuring regulatory compliance (HACCP, FDA, GFS Primus) and the production of safe, quality, and wholesome produce. Overall responsibility for food safety, quality and USDA Organic and compliance.

Responsibilities & Duties: 
  • The Food Safety Manager maintains and supervises all Food Safety and USDA Organic compliance.
  • Must be a hands-on manager that is able to train and demonstrate how to effectively coach and train the food safety staff.
  • The Food Safety Manager ensures that all Food Safety programs are functioning as designed, being followed by all appropriate personnel, and also being correctly documented.  Further, that all programs in place are valid and following all legal as well as audit format requirements.
  • The Food Safety Manager must be able to quickly, yet thoroughly, investigate a product/process failure to determine the root cause as well as what corrective actions are needed.
  • The Food Safety Manager must be thoroughly versed in 3rd party Food Safety Audits as well as be prepared to be the primary contact for all audit events as well as  handling the collection of  3rd party documentation.
  • Must quickly gain an understanding of all of our safety policies and procedures and be able to express those policies to others as needed.
  • The Food Safety Manager will be responsible for ensuring that the cleanliness and safety of the warehouse is maintained.
  • Must work collaboratively with the other managers to accomplish the goals of the department.
  • Excellent communication skills with internal and external customers.

Qualifications: 
  • Degree in Food Sciences, Agricultural food Science or other applicable discipline is preferred.
  • A minimum of five years of related experience in a food processing environment. At least three years of supervisory experience.
  • Must demonstrate proficient PC skills.
  • Must demonstrate exceptional oral and written communication skills. Bi-lingual preferred.
  • Experience working with relational databases, statistical programs, and other tools to compile and interpret quantitative data.
  • Experience with audits such as GFSI (PRIMUS) FDA,, USDA Organic and etc.
  • Expert knowledge developing/implementing SOP’s, SSOP’s, HACCP, and GMP’s.
  • Must be familiar with environmental (microbiological) requirements/testing procedures and trace- back/recall program.
  • Experience in the fresh fruit/vegetable industry or food experience strongly preferred.
